The multiplayer part of Metal Gear Solid 5: The Phantom Pain, Metal Gear Online, launched last week, but gamers suffered serious matchmaking and server issues. To make up for it, Konami has apologized and given some gifts to those who had to deal with the rocky launch.
Every player has been rewarded a hefty 3000 GP, which will be given after today’s server maintenance. Additionally, the XP Boost period has been extended to three weeks instead of two.
